The day's highlight was the ride over Atigun Pass which is the highest point on the Dalton highway. Claude and I were camped at the same location, called Farthest North Spruce, so we rode up together. It was delightfully cool when we started the assent up the first steep two mile section. The road then levels for five miles and continues steeply (12% grade) to the top. The road was surface rough and you needed to be careful going down the other side too. I’m now camped at the beginning of the North Slope section which is treeless arctic tundra.
